CFO South Africa Newsletter | Thursday November 13 Dear CFO South Africa Member, Read Exclusive CFO South Africa Articles CA examination changes – good news or bad news? Close to three quarters of CFOs of listed South African companies are South African Chartered Accountants (SAICA research published October 2014). November 2014 sees a major shift in the focus and form of the final assessment written to qualify as a chartered accountant. Is this good news or bad news for current and future CFOs and the staff that they employ? CFO of the Week: Vuyo Mafata (UIF): investing billions for the unemployed “What makes me get out of bed in the morning is the contribution that I think I can make to the plight of the unemployed in South Africa,” says Vuyo Mafata, CFO at the Unemployment Insurance Fund (UIF). In this interview Mafata talks about the challenges of being a CFO in a governmental organisation and the exciting responsibility he has of managing an investment portfolio of more than R100 billion. KPMG throws its weight behind CFO South Africa Professional services firm KPMG will be the principal sponsor for the next year of CFO South Africa, the dedicated networking and knowledge sharing platform for CFOs and Financial Directors. In addition to sponsoring six events, KPMG will be also be the main partner for the 2015 CFO Awards, a prestigious gala event that recognises leaders in South Africa’s finance world.
